- Access to registered server is not permitted ?The SAP error message GW748 ("Access to registered server is not permitted") typically occurs in the context of SAP Gateway and indicates that there is an issue with the authorization or configuration settings that prevent access to a registered server. Here are some potential causes, solutions, and related information for this error:
Causes:
- Authorization Issues: The user or service account trying to access the registered server may not have the necessary authorizations or roles assigned.
- Server Configuration: The server may not be properly configured to allow access from the requesting client or user.
- Network Restrictions: Firewalls or network policies may be blocking access to the server.
- Gateway Settings: The SAP Gateway settings may not be correctly configured to allow access to the registered server.
- Client-Specific Settings: The client settings in SAP may restrict access to certain servers.
Solutions:
Check User Authorizations:
- Ensure that the user or service account has the necessary roles and authorizations to access the registered server. You can check this in transaction
PFCG
(Role Maintenance) to see if the required roles are assigned.Review Server Configuration:
- Verify the configuration of the registered server in the SAP Gateway. You can check the settings in transaction
SMGW
(Gateway Monitor) and ensure that the server is correctly registered and accessible.Network Configuration:
- Check for any network restrictions, such as firewalls or security groups, that may be preventing access to the server. Ensure that the necessary ports are open and that the server is reachable from the client.
Gateway Settings:
- Review the settings in the SAP Gateway to ensure that it is configured to allow access to the registered server. You can check the settings in transaction
SPRO
under the relevant configuration path for SAP Gateway.Client-Specific Settings:
- If the issue is client-specific, check the client settings in transaction
SCC4
to ensure that there are no restrictions on accessing the registered server.Check for System Updates:
- Ensure that your SAP system is up to date with the latest patches and updates, as there may be bug fixes related to this error.
